Answer:
A firm pursuing a strategy based on customization and variety will tend to structure and manage its supply chain to accommodate more _variation__ than a firm pursuing a strategy based on low cost and high volume
Explanation:
The variation of the product means any change which changes the "physical attributes of an item" or the terms in which it is marketed "as altering the colour of a sugar pack. This is achieved by companies to increase their own market share.

Answer:
the cost of goods sold to be recorded at January 14 is: $230 .
Explanation:
LIFO (Last in First out) method, assumes that the last goods purchased are the <em>first ones</em> to be issued to the final customer.
This means that valuation of inventory will begin using the value of the <em>earliest</em> goods purchased.
The Cost of goods sold is calculated as follows :
Cost of goods sold : 9 units × $14 = $126
13 units × $8 = $104
Total = $230
Answer:
(A) $144,000.
Explanation:
For computing the indirect costs allocated to the Commercial Department first we have to compute the per unit cost which is shown below:
Per unit cost = (Allocated department overhead indirect cost) ÷ (total number of direct labor hours)
= $396,000 ÷ 22,000
= $18
The total number of direct labor hours = Consumer + commercial
= 14,000 + 8,000
= 22,000
Now the indirect cost equal to
= Per unit cost × Commercial direct labor hours
= $18 × 8,000
= $144,000
